Car key fobs have transponder chips which communicate with your car's internal computer system. If you own a newer model car, it's likely that the key fob you have is equipped with this type of chip. The technician will insert a blank transponder in your key and program it to match the settings of your car's system.

While some cars allow the owner to do their own reprogramming, this typically requires special equipment. It is recommended that you read the manual of your car to find out how you can do it. If you don't have access to the manual, a locksmith will be able to program your car key fob for you.

Misplaced car keys

Car keys are small and fit into almost every pocket and bag, making them one of the most frequently lost items. It is believed that people lose their car keys at least once per year.

Most modern vehicles, unlike older keys without transponder chips, have transponder chips that connect to the vehicle's computer in order to unlock or start the engine. The majority of these keys can be programmed and changed at a locksmith or key programmer near you. Utilizing an online search for a key programmer, like 'car key programmer near me' can assist you in finding the best firm to get the job done quickly and Mobile Key Programming Near Me efficiently.

The procedure to program the new key is straightforward, but it can vary slightly based on the vehicle and the manufacturer. You can often find the exact instructions for your specific car in its owner's manual. In most cases, the key needs to be inserted, switched on and off several times before it is properly programmed.

You'll have to visit a dealership to program the key for the latest cars. Some manufacturers use an approach to ensure that only their dealers can make new keys. Locksmiths cannot copy them.
